Career path

Certified Specialist Programme in Wildlife Habitat Law Enforcement: UK Career Outlook

Career Role Description
Wildlife Crime Investigator Investigate poaching, illegal wildlife trade, and habitat destruction; requires strong fieldwork and investigative skills.
Wildlife Habitat Enforcement Officer Enforce legislation protecting wildlife habitats; involves patrolling, inspections, and community engagement.
Conservation Law Specialist Provide legal expertise on wildlife and habitat protection; crucial for policy development and legal actions.
Environmental Compliance Officer (Wildlife Focus) Ensure organizations comply with environmental laws related to wildlife; requires strong auditing and reporting skills.
